Benefits of Proper Black Refrigerator Parts

  • Exact Compatibility: Original equipment manufacturer (OEM) components provide precise fit and function.
  • Adaptable Coverage: Universal Black parts often work across several models.
  • Cost Savings: Universal options tend to be less expensive.
  • Faster Fulfillment: Universal Black parts are usually more widely stocked.
  • Reliable Legacy Use: Older appliances may rely on universal components when OEM Black parts are obsolete.

How to Choose Black Refrigerator Parts

  • Match Your Model: Choose OEM or model-specific Black parts for critical systems.
  • Check Universal Features: Ensure compatibility with voltage, size and mount points.
  • Evaluate Quality: Universal Black parts vary — choose trusted brands or reinforced designs.
  • Consider Warranty: OEM Black parts better preserve warranty coverage.
  • Plan for Future Repairs: Stock common Black parts, like gaskets or drawers, for convenience.


Maintenance Tips

  • Inspect Periodically: Check seals, shelves or hinges for wear.
  • Clean Contacts: Wipe electrical connectors to maintain signal integrity.
  • Lubricate Moving Components: Use food-safe lubricant when appropriate.
  • Correct Misalignment: Adjust door gaskets or guides if Black parts drift.
  • Store Spare Black Parts Safely: Keep unused parts in original packaging or a dry case.
